The purpose of this Technical Bulletin is to inform you about the EU Battery Directive that come in force
September 26, 2008.
As of September 26, 2008 the EU Battery Directive 2006/66/EC requires that all batteries shipped to EU
member states need to be properly labeled, and the below recycling or disposal instruction needs to be
accompanied in the user documentation. This requirement is concerning also the batteries that are
incorporated in the Printed Circuit Assemblies. However, batteries or equipment that have been
imported to EU prior to September 26, 2008 do not need to be labeled.
The separate collection symbol is affixed to a battery, or its packaging, to advise you that the battery
must be recycled or disposed of in accordance with local or country laws. The letters below the
separate collection symbol indicate whether certain elements (Pb=Lead, Cd=Cadmium, Hg=Mercury)
are contained in the battery. To minimize potential effects on the environment and human health, it is
important that all marked batteries that you remove from the product are properly recycled or
disposed. For information on how the battery may be safely removed from the device, please consult
the Technical Reference manual or equipment instructions. Information on the potential effects on the
environment and human health of the substances used in batteries is available at this URL:
